After a delay of over a year, Sony has confirmed a new early-June Blu-ray release date for 'Glory.'
Originally scheduled for a February 2007 Blu-ray release, Sony subsequently yanked the title from its schedule without explanation. The studio has now confirmed a new Blu-ray date of June 2 for the Ed Zwick-directed Civil War drama.
Tech specs will see 1080p/AVC MPEG-4 video (2.35:1) and English Dolby TrueHD 5.1 Surround audio.
There's no word on bonus features as of yet, though a package comparable to the previous special edition DVD version appears likely.
Suggested list price for the Blu-ray has been set at $28.99.
